The good news there is that Coty Sensabaugh will finally be back on the field. He is a very good nickel corner. The Titans have really missed him during his absence.
Sammie Hill didn't practice today with because of a hamstring injury. It sounds like he is a long shot to play on Sunday.
Nate Washington practiced, even if just on a limited basis, all week. My guess is that he will be out there on Sunday.

The biggest name there is Jimmy Smith, but it was announced earlier in the week that he will miss the rest of the season, so there are no surprises on their list. The Ravens secondary will be ripe for the pickin' for Zach Mettenberger on Sunday.
